Canadian astronaut Jeremy Hansen is set to engage with the public in a live question-and-answer session from space, offering a rare opportunity for people to connect directly with a crew member aboard a mission beyond Earth.
The interactive event is expected to draw significant attention as audiences across Canada and beyond prepare to hear firsthand insights about life and work in space.
A Unique Opportunity for Public Engagement
The session will allow participants to submit questions to Jeremy Hansen in real time, covering a wide range of topics—from scientific research and daily routines in orbit to the challenges of long-duration spaceflight.
Organizers say the initiative is aimed at inspiring curiosity and interest in space exploration, particularly among young people.
